Educational Benefits
Word search puzzles improve vocabulary, spelling recognition, and pattern recognition skills. Children develop visual scanning abilities and attention to detail. Adults maintain cognitive function and memory through regular puzzle solving. Teachers use custom word searches to reinforce subject vocabulary in fun, engaging way.
Create themed puzzles for specific topics: science terms, historical figures, math vocabulary, foreign language words. Use for spelling tests, review activities, homework assignments, or extra credit. Word searches work great for substitutes, early finishers, or brain break activities.

Tips for Creating Great Puzzles
Use 6-12 words for optimal difficulty - too few makes puzzles too easy, too many causes crowding. Keep word lengths varied between 4-10 letters for balanced challenge. Choose related words for themed puzzles, or mix random words for variety. Longer words are easier to spot than short words.
Start with Easy direction mode for kids or beginners. Medium mode offers good challenge for most players. Hard mode with all 8 directions creates expert-level puzzles. Larger grids allow more words but take longer to solve. Test your puzzle before printing to ensure it's the right difficulty.
